The Last Hero (One shot, /sup/)

  1. >You hear a scream in the night
  2. >It’s down an alleyway on your right hand side
  3. >You stop for a moment but start walking again soon afterwards
  4. >A second scream
  5. >You stop again with a sigh
  6. >Turning around you throw your jacket’s hood up and run towards the noise
  7. >Two men are shaking down a young girl with light pink hair in a yellow sweater
  8. “I assume you two were just escorting this nice girl home safely right?”
  9. >They both turn to look at you, one has a gun, the other a knife
  10. >”Fuck off man or you’re gonna get it too. We just need a little pocket change that’s all.”
  11. “I get it, times are tough, not that tough though. Just lay off of her ok?”
  12. >”Man fuck this, let’s just get him too.”
  13. >The one with the knife spoke up and began walking towards you
  14. >You steel yourself
  15. >Maybe it wouldn’t be so bad this time
  16. >Yeah, not likely
  17. >You wait until he gets in striking range and let him make the first move
  18. >He stabs straight for your gut with his arm fully extended
  19. >He must not get in a lot of actual fights
  20. >You side step the attack and grab his wrist
  21. >Pulling him forward and off balance you smash the elbow of your other arm into his temple sending him to the ground
  22. >You turn to see the gunman staring in anger and disbelief
  23. >You begin walking towards him when he raises the gun at you
  24. >You’re only about ten feet apart when he does which puts you in position to dash at him if you need to
  25. >He had completely forgotten the girl who had scurried away to hide behind a dumpster
  26. >That’s good at least
  27. “Can we please just not?”
  28. >It’s worth a shot
  29. >”Fuck you, you crazy ass townie.”
  30. >You shake your head and sigh with exasperation
  31. >It can never just be easy
  32. “Okay then.”
  33. >You don’t wait for him to respond
  34. >Your muscles tense and coil before rebounding and sending you flying at the man
  35. >You see three bright flashes accompanied by a feminine scream and feel three bullets tear through your flesh
  36. >You don’t stop and when you get to the man you tackle him around the waist
  37. >The mangled couple that you form crashes to the ground with dull thuds and you wrestle the gun away from him
  38. >Clambering on top of him you send three heavy blows to his head leaving him unconscious
  39. >You see crimson pools forming on his chest from your agonizing wounds
  40. >That’s when you hear the other one step up behind you
  41. >You try to turn in time to stop him but only get halfway and earn a knife between the back of your ribs for your trouble
  42. >The blade tears into you like searing acid and drives the air from your lungs
  43. >A second, third, and fourth excruciating wound flare forth on your back before you’re able to get up and turn around
  44. >You look at the man who just stabbed you and he stares at you unbelieving
  45. “I t-think I still h-have something of yours.”
  46. >You wheeze through the words as blood begins to pool in your lungs
  47. >You have to cough to clear your passage before shoving a thumb over your shoulder to indicate his knife
  48. >He sees the blood trails, the gaping wounds from bullet and blade alike
  49. >He takes one step backwards
  50. >Then another
  51. >Then he turns and flees entirely
  52. >Once he’s out of the alleyway you let yourself collapse
  53. >Your body slaps the ground with a wet smack and you roll when you feel the blade driven deeper into your back
  54. >You lay on your side wheezing and sputtering with blood spraying from your lips with each cough
  55. >Rushed footsteps from the dumpster catch your attention
  56. >The girl is right beside you in only a moment and you can hear her ragged weeping
  57. >She reaches out to touch you but recoils at the sight of your ghastly wounds
  58. >”Oh my gosh! You need a doctor! Why would you do that?”
  59. >You weakly waive a hand in dismissal trying to reassure her
  60. “I’ll *cough* be ok. You mind helping me with this?”
  61. >You once again point to the knife embedded in your back
  62. >You see her hesitate
  63. >”W-what do you mean?”
  64. “Just pull i- *cough* pull it out.”
  65. >”Are you sure?”
  66. >You nod
  67. >She moves around your backside and feel her grab the knife but she doesn’t pull
  68. “Do it. One swift motion.”
  69. >A fresh trail of anguish erupts as she does as instructed
  70. >You gasp and splutter as the pain overtakes you
  71. >You barely have the faculties the hear the girl frantically whispering how sorry she is to you on top of her racking sobs
  72. >When the both of you finally calm down you push yourself up into a sitting position and crawl to the wall of one of the surrounding buildings
  73. >You prop yourself against it and the girl scurries over to you pulling out her phone
  74. >She starts fumbling with it trying to type in a number but you put your hand over it
  75. >She looks at you in confusion and fear as you shake your head
  76. >Instead you lift your shirt revealing your bare stomach
  77. >There were three bullet holes and the girl recoils at the sight
  78. >You roll your eyes
  79. >Motioning her closer with a hand you point a finger at one of the holes
  80. >That’s when she notices that it’s slowly closing over until there’s only scar tissue remaining that joins a cavalcade of others like it
  81. >In an astounded voice she asks
  82. >”W-who are you? I thought all of the heroes were gone.”
  83. >You cough up a glob of blood and spit it out
  84. “They are.”
  85.  
  86. End
